The first and last president of the USSR, Mikhail Gorbachev, married Raisa, whom he adored while still a student. The marriage was registered in the fall of 1953. Soon the young spouses had a tragedy, they lost a child. Gorbachev gave a frank interview to "Komsomolke".

According to him, Raisa Maksimovna became pregnant soon after the wedding. However, doctors discouraged her from giving birth: the year before, Gorbachev experienced a serious illness that caused a serious complication of the heart. It was impossible to bear a child, but the Gorbachevs had already come up with a name for their future son, Sergey.

Mikhail Sergeyevich was given an ultimatum: either he keeps his wife alive or allows her to give birth. In fact, Gorbachev had no choice. Pregnancy was interrupted.

Gorbachev's only daughter, Irina, was born in 1957, almost immediately after their arrival in Stavropol.
